Notifications & Preferences#
Notifications help you stay informed about activity in your courses. You can view notifications on the platform or receive them by email, depending on your preferences.
Where Notifications Appear#
Notification Tray#
The bell icon in the top-right corner opens the notifications tray. A count next to the bell icon shows the number of unseen notifications.#
The notification tray keeps you updated while you are browsing the site.
Select the bell icon in the top-right corner to open the notifications tray with tabs such as Discussions, Updates, and Grading.
Each notification shows the associated course, the time since it was created, and a red dot that indicates that it has not been clicked.
A gear icon in the tray takes you directly to your notification preferences on the Account Settings page.
If you have more notifications than can fit in the tray, a Load more button appears at the bottom. Select it to load more notifications.
Email Notifications#
Screenshot of an email containing a daily summary of notifications from the past 24 hours.#
Notification emails keep you informed when you are away from the platform. Depending on your preferences, you can receive email notifications immediately or as a daily or weekly summary.
Immediately: Receive the email notification as soon as the activity happens.
Daily: Receive a summary of notifications from the past 24 hours.
Weekly: Receive a summary of notifications from the past 7 days.
Email summaries contain up to 5 notifications for each platform area (Discussions, Updates, Grading). Select View more to see the rest in the notification tray on the platform.
Emails include a one-click unsubscribe option to turn off email notifications for all activity types.

Managing Preferences#
You can manage notification preferences on the Account Settings page.#
Notification preferences allow you to control which notifications you receive, how often you receive them, and which channels they use. You can open the preferences page from:
The Notifications section on the Account Settings page.
The gear icon in the top-right corner of the notification tray.
The Notification Settings link at the bottom of notifications in email.
For each preference, you can:
Turn tray notifications on or off.
Turn email notifications on or off.
Choose an email cadence: Immediately, Daily, or Weekly.
Notifications Expiry#
Your site administrator may set a time limit for how long notifications remain available. Once they reach that age, they are automatically removed from your notification tray.
